The UltraClear laser can be used to target sun-damaged skin, remove pre-cancerous cells, and reduce the risk of developing skin cancer.

TAMPA, Fla. — May is Skin Cancer Awareness Month. According to the American Academy of Dermatology, skin cancer is the most common cancer in the United States. Melanoma is the most serious type of skin cancer because of its likeliness to spread if not detected and treated early.

While prevention by protecting yourself against the sun, using sunscreen, and regular skin checks is crucial, more and more doctors are using laser technology to protect against skin cancer as well. We stopped by Dr. John Sosa’s office in South Tampa.

“There’s evidence out there that we can possibly reduce the skin cancer risk by decreasing photodamage or the sun-induced damage in the skin,” he said.
